Also auto-saves a scaled-down version of the image, for faster animations or quicker viewing on my wireless link. Designed to be called from cron every 1/2 hour (when intellicast updates their page). It could be modified to grab any piece of data off of any web page fairly easily, such as a favorite comic strip... The script sets the referrer correctly, so the problems with directly requesting the image file are avoided. :) You will need to modify the URL variable(s) some if you don't want the Chicago-area map. It should be fairly easy to figure out. Also of interest will be my auto-animation generator that takes the image files in a given range and generates an animation of them.
